We followed route 400 along the coast all the way to Fethiye except for the detour to Patara
On the drive up to Fethiye we stopped at ancient Myra, and the church of St. Nicholas. It was very hot (still in the heat wave) and there were hordes of Russian tourist groups at both places, but still worth the visit.
Later in the afternoon we arrived at Patara were we stopped for a swim at beautiful Patara beach and a late afternoon walk through the ruins of ancient Patara. It was just us and 2 other people in the ruins. Next time I will spend a bit more time here.
As we drove up the coast this day from Cirali we saw lots of small beaches to stop and swim, but all of them had someone at the top charging money to get into. It is so different from Canada where there are so many public parks and beaches that are open to all free of charge (taxpayer funded).
Duygu Pension, Fethiye
90 YL triple, 60 TL double
Located in a lovely, quiet neighborhood just west of the town centre, with beautiful bay views. This place had the tiniest rooms, the roughest bedsheets, and the smallest wet bathrooms we experienced on our trip. The owner asked us to give him good reviews on Trip Advisor, but I can only give mixed reviews. Next time I would probably look for another place.
